## Startup Overview

This validation engine automatically checks digital ad creatives against the strict technical specifications of ad networks and publishers before launch. It ingests video, display, and rich media assets, instantly verifying file sizes, bitrates, dimensions, and tracking tags against a constantly updated database of publisher rules.

Media buyers, ad agencies, and brand marketing teams face routine campaign delays when publishers reject assets for minor formatting errors. Instead of relying on manual QA workflows or heavy campaign management suites like Mediaocean, production teams route their finalized files directly through the validation endpoint. It flags non-compliant technical elements immediately, preventing rework and missed launch windows.

Unlike visual compliance dashboards such as CreativeX, the platform is structurally headless for zero-latency execution within existing asset management pipelines. By operating strictly in the background and charging exclusively per successful deployment, it aligns infrastructure costs directly with actual campaign delivery rather than software seats or raw asset volume.

## Startup Top Risks

**Risks**:
- Severity: existential · Description: Major ad networks alter their technical creative specifications without warning, causing the validation engine to approve non-compliant assets and breaking deployments. · Mitigation Status: unmitigated
- Severity: high · Description: The per-successful-deployment pricing model creates massive compute costs without revenue when clients submit large volumes of non-compliant assets that fail validation. · Mitigation Status: in-progress
- Severity: high · Description: Walled-garden publishers bundle their own zero-latency validation APIs directly into DSPs, rendering a third-party headless validation layer unnecessary. · Mitigation Status: unmitigated
- Severity: moderate · Description: Media agency QA teams refuse to adopt a headless API workflow, forcing the development of an expensive UI to match legacy competitors like Mediaocean. · Mitigation Status: unmitigated
